Red Velvet and Lace Cookies

I have heard of red velvet cake before, but have never made it because I never have a full bottle of red food dye on hand. The cake mix easily solved that problem. The coloring is already in the mix.

The recipe suggests baking the cookies for 8-10 minutes. I chose to bake them for 8 minutes and they came out very moist and delicious. 

To make Red Velvet and Lace Cookies, simply follow Caitlin's recipe:

Ingredients:

1 box of Red Velvet Cake Mix
2 eggs
1/3 cup oil
Powdered sugar

Directions:

Preheat oven to 375 degrees. Mix together one box of Red Velvet Cake Mix, the eggs, and oil. 

Having never used Red Velvet Cake Mix before, 
it was interesting to see the mix turn from brown to 
bright red as it was mixed with the wet ingredients.

Then roll teaspoon-sized balls of dough in powdered sugar.

Ready to be rolled in powdered sugar.

Next, place on a baking stone (or parchment paper lined cookie sheet). Bake for 8-10 minutes. Cookies will crackle on top. 

Cookies cooling before we taste them.

Let cool and enjoy!
